Output 6b7cf96d4de2a72e4aea240dbdddecd598771dd597835689bd27c559e27ce75e:1

value
561562
script pubkey
OP_0 OP_PUSHBYTES_20 bfa92cde717397651b4d41265d122a13bfeb7a21
address
bc1qh75jehn3wwtk2x6dgyn96y32zwl7k73psf4thh
transaction
6b7cf96d4de2a72e4aea240dbdddecd598771dd597835689bd27c559e27ce75e
confirmations
30787
spent
true